Neocatenulostroma microsporum
Neocatenulostroma microsporum (Joanne E. Taylor & Crous) Quaedvl. & Crous, in Quaedvlieg et al., Persoonia 33: 26 (2014).
≡ Trimmatostroma microsporum Joanne E. Taylor & Crous, Mycol. Res. 104(5): 631 (2000).
Index Fungorum number: IF 807808; Facesoffungi number: FoF 12624, Fig. 1

Fig. 1 Neocatenulostroma microsporum (PREM 56207a; redrawn from Taylor and Crous 2000) a Ascoma in cross section. b Ascospores. c Asci. d Conidia. Scale bars = 10 μm.
Importance and distribution
Neocatenulostroma comprises only three species known on two host plants in Pinaceae and Proteaceae. Neocatenulostroma is reported from Africa (Western Cape Province) and Europe (Germany).
